The street in brief

Sales on Tennyson Street are mostly terraced houses. Homes here typically change hands around £49,750 — roughly 69% below the DN21 norm. Per square metre of floor space it comes to about £1,008, below the district's £1,758. The street has been outpacing the DN21 trend. HM Land Registry records 54 sales across 26 homes since 2001.

Tennyson Street's £49,750 median sits about 69% below DN21's £160,000; on floor space it runs £1,008/m² against the district's £1,758/m² (-43%).

Street and DN21 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.

Sales marked non-standardare Land Registry “additional price paid” entries — bulk purchases, repossessions, right-to-buy and similar transfers. They're listed for completeness but excluded from every median and comparison figure on this page.
